Web13 jul. 2013 · Really good rifle bullets can travel as far as 4.5 miles. A typical 223 Rem can travel about 3 miles and even a lowly 22 LR can go a mile and a half. This does not account for ricochets, which can add a considerable distance. Air density influences bullet friction, as does the bullet's ballistic coefficient and wind. Web20 mrt. 2024 · A: There are many factors that can affect how far a bullet can travel. These include the type of firearm, the type of cartridge, the condition of both the firearm and the cartridge, the platform being used, wind speed and direction, temperature,, and elevation. All of these factors can have a significant impact on the maximum range of a bullet.
